Andercol S.A., O-tek’s resin supplier in Colombia, consumes 3.5 million kilos of recycled polyester PET resin annually from 140 million PET bottles (0.6 liters each), i.e. up to 10 bottles are recycled per 1 kilogram of new resin. The sorted, cleaned and shredded PET plastic is recycled by a depolymerization process. In order to meet the high-quality standards of GRP Pipe production, the recycled raw material is mixed with new one at a ratio of 1:3.

Approximately 30 kg of polyester resin is required to produce one meter of an average drainage Flowtite GRP pipe (e.g. 120 cm in diameter). In other words, a 6-meter pipe of this diameter enables the recycling of around 1800 plastic bottles. In Colombia, more than 4,000 million! PET bottles are put into circulation every year, but just around 31% are recycled. O-tek is doing its bit for the environment by using polyester resin from Andercol, thus, activating the recycling process of a significant amount of PET bottles to manufacture GRP pipes, which in turn are intended for sewage disposal and/or drinking water supply for millions of Colombians.

Every recycled PET bottle that does not end up in landfill or in the sea is a benefit for the environment.
